KS Industry is advancing its defense AI solutions in partnership with the artificial intelligence (AI) technology company CrowdWorks.

On June 12, KS Industry announced that it had signed a memorandum of understanding (MOU) with CrowdWorks for mutual growth in the defense AI transformation (AX) business sector.


The purpose of the agreement is to further develop 'SentinAI,' an edge LM MRO platform based on humanoid AI that KS Industry is currently developing. SentinAI is a next-generation AI MRO platform that combines smart glasses optimized for high-noise and closed network environments, bone conduction audio, an integrated vocal cord vibration microphone, and an edge small language model (sLM). This enables real-time maintenance support even in environments with severe communication restrictions, such as military aircraft.


CrowdWorks plans to collaborate by integrating its 'Workstage'—a data collection and processing management platform compliant with defense security protocols—and the 'Alpy Knowledge Compiler,' which automatically pre-processes various types of document data into AI-readable formats, into the SentinAI system.


Based on this collaboration with CrowdWorks, KS Industry intends to accelerate its new business roadmap, which involves applying physical AI, ontology, and robotics technologies to military power support systems.



A KS Industry representative stated, "We are confident that KS Industry's edge AI commercialized products, enabled by this strategic partnership with CrowdWorks, will make a meaningful contribution to improving efficiency at defense MRO sites."
